ECB's 'free money' has supported banks more than the economy
Published Tue, Mar 28, 2017 · 09:50 PM
Frankfurt
WHEN the European Central Bank announced its targeted lending programme back in 2014, policy makers including President Mario Draghi held out great hopes that it would finally get financial institutions extending credit to companies and households again.
Based on that narrow measure, it has been a flop.
